Shin Hye Noh is a scholar working on Pulmonary and Respiratory Medicine, Cell Biology and Epidemiology. According to data from OpenAlex, Shin Hye Noh has authored 13 papers receiving a total of 473 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Pulmonary and Respiratory Medicine, 7 papers in Cell Biology and 4 papers in Epidemiology. Recurrent topics in Shin Hye Noh’s work include Therapeutic Advances in Cystic Fibrosis Research (7 papers), Cellular transport and secretion (7 papers) and Endoplasmic Reticulum Stress and Disease (6 papers). Shin Hye Noh is often cited by papers focused on Therapeutic Advances in Cystic Fibrosis Research (7 papers), Cellular transport and secretion (7 papers) and Endoplasmic Reticulum Stress and Disease (6 papers). Shin Hye Noh collaborates with scholars based in South Korea, United States and Japan. Shin Hye Noh's co-authors include Min Goo Lee, Heon Yung Gee, Kyung Hwan Kim, Bor Luen Tang, Jiyoon Kim, Joo Young Kim, Jeong Ho Seok, Dong Hee Kim, Hyun‐Soo Cho and Kuglae Kim and has published in prestigious journals such as Cell, Nature Communications and The Journal of Physiology.
